How AI Chatbots Are Changing News Discovery

AI chatbots are changing the way readers discover news, but the deeper shift is not only technical. It is also about which sources feel trustworthy, quotable and structurally easy for systems to surface.

Discovery is shifting from search boxes to conversational interfaces

That changes how readers encounter a publication and how clearly a story’s structure helps machines interpret it.

Trust signals are becoming even more visible

Clear bylines, descriptive headlines, direct summaries and honest labeling all help a publication remain quotable and easier to surface.

The article itself still matters

Systems can help readers find a page, but the page must still deliver readability, context and a reason to trust what it is saying.

Publishers need durable pages, not only transient posts

Topic hubs, explainers and well-structured archive pages can become more valuable as discovery habits keep changing.
